WebJul 7, 2024 · Can you sell options when the market is closed? In case you didn’t know, options market hours run from 9:30 am to 4:00 pm Eastern Standard Time. Since the option’s value is derived from the price of the underlying stock, once the underlying stops trading, there’s no reason for options to continue trading. So, there is no after hours ... WebApr 11, 2024 · For stocks, this starts at 4PM Eastern time all the way to 8PM Eastern time. We could also consider the timeframe before the market opens as after hours. Typically, traders can start trading with most brokers at 7am Eastern Time meaning 2.5 hours before the official opening of the stock market. This window of trading is known as pre-market.
